Abstract

A button fire alarm belongs to manual fire alarm, defined in standard EN54-11, portion 11. The manual fire alarm is divided into type A and type B. In type A, the alarm is sent by crushing or removing a fragile component. In type B, a releasing component is additionally operated, such as a button. The glass sheet is used in manual fire alarm of type B and essential to be punched before the releasing component is operated, in order to operate the releasing component. The invention relates to a button fire alarm (1) comprising an operation component to send an alarm signal on operating; a reducible piece device (3) for protecting the operation component (4) from manually being operated by operator at protecting position and releasing the operation component (4) at releasing position to be operated by operator, characterized in that a shifting unit (5,6,7;8,9;10,11;13,15,16;19,20) is constituted to guide the piece device (3) from protecting position to releasing position.
